The Role:

  • Providing 1:1 and small-group support to pupils with SEMH needs
  • Building positive and trusting relationships with students
  • Supporting emotional regulation, resilience and engagement in learning
  • Implementing behaviour support strategies and intervention plans
  • Managing challenging behaviour using positive and restorative approaches
  • Acting as a positive role model both inside and outside the classroom
  • Working closely with teachers, pastoral teams, SENCOs and external professionals
  • Supporting pupils who may have experienced trauma, exclusion or disrupted education
